如何利用Serverless构建实时供应链管理

神秘剑客 2022-08-14 ⋅ 21 阅读

供应链管理是一个关键领域,对于企业的运营效率和客户满意度至关重要。而Serverless架构提供了一种灵活、可靠且高效的方式来构建实时供应链管理系统。本文将介绍如何使用Serverless构建一个具有丰富功能的实时供应链管理系统。

什么是Serverless?

Serverless是一种云计算模型,它不需要预先配置或管理服务器。开发者只需要编写代码,并将其部署到云平台上,云平台会自动根据需求来分配计算资源。这种模型使得开发者能够专注于业务逻辑,而无需关心基础设施的管理。

Serverless在供应链管理中的优势

  1. 弹性扩展:供应链管理系统通常需要处理大量的数据和请求,使用Serverless可以根据需求自动扩展计算资源,确保系统的高可用性和性能。

  2. 实时数据处理:Serverless架构具备处理实时数据的能力,可以快速处理和传输供应链中的数据,提供实时的商业洞察和决策支持。

  3. 低成本:Serverless基于按需计费模式,只有在代码执行时才会产生费用,节约了服务器和基础设施的成本。

构建实时供应链管理系统的步骤

以下是使用Serverless构建实时供应链管理系统的一般步骤:

  1. 设计数据架构:根据供应链管理的需求,设计合适的数据模型和数据流程。包括供应商信息、物流信息、库存信息等。

  2. 选择合适的Serverless平台:根据需求和预算选择一家可靠的Serverless平台,如AWS Lambda、Google Cloud Functions等。

  3. 开发函数:根据设计好的数据架构,编写函数来处理数据的存储、更新和查询等操作。这些函数可以使用不同的编程语言来实现。

  4. 集成第三方服务:如果需要与其他系统或服务进行集成,例如支付系统或电子商务平台,可以使用Serverless的事件触发功能来实现。

  5. 设置实时数据流:利用Serverless的消息队列或流处理功能,实现供应链管理系统中的实时数据流,确保数据的快速处理和传输。

  6. 监控和优化:使用Serverless平台提供的监控工具来监控系统的性能和稳定性,及时进行优化和调整。

结论

使用Serverless构建实时供应链管理系统,可以提供弹性扩展、实时数据处理和低成本等优势。通过遵循上述步骤,您可以轻松构建一个功能丰富且高效的供应链管理系统,提高企业的运营效率和客户满意度。


全部评论: 0

    我有话说: